Proposes particular requirements for the safe design and manufacture of mammographic X-ray equipment and mammographic stereotactic devices. A thorough working knowledge of its parent Standard AS/NZS 3200.1.0, or a readily available copy, is necessary to deal with some of the technical issues raised. The proposed Standard is identical with and reproduced from IEC 60601-2-45:1998. Proposed as a Joint Australian/New Zealand Standard.
